NFL News: Dolphins Fire Cam Cameron

After a 1-15 season Dolphins coach Cam Cameron has been fired by the Dolphins. (AP Images)

 

The Miami Dolphins have fired head coach Cam Cameron.

"We just felt in order to move forward and not look back, we needed someone in place who shared the same philosophical compatibilities we shared," new GM Jeff Ireland said. "We didn't really know the guy that well. We were going to try to get someone that does share those things, and we weren't completely sold that he did."

There was speculation Cameron was going to be fired after former GM Randy Mueller was fired on Tuesday, and it looks the rumors were true. New VP of football operations Bill Parcells is looking to clean house after the Dolphins had a abysmal 1-15 season.
